OTHER SCHOOLS:
Adelphi: is looking to relax transfer restrictions. Requires 30 credits at their school. Will only accept 90 credits for transfer.
An admissions counselor said that Adelphi might relax their credit restrictions and degree requirements more, but the student must speak with their department's dean and do a course evaluation first.

They accept no more than 90 credits. Scholarships will be available at GPA's of 3.0 or above. Can take up to 18 credits for the flat-fee, more than that per semester will cost more for those wishing to take more classes. Classes of C- will transfer, below won't. Winter classes are very limited and Summer classes don't have financial aid.

Hofstra: Requires 30 credits at their school.
Hofstra is only taking 65 credits but they are seeing if they can get that raised. Chances are they won't raise it higher than Adelphi at this point.

LIU Post: is attempting to try to match financial aid and possibly relax the transfer limits, but it is still up in the air. Also Only C's or higher will transfer. They will only be taking a max of 96 credits. liu.edu/dowling
Molloy: The ONLY confirmed school having a teach-out agreement; you can keep all of your credits. Other schools are offering to waive transfer fees, not let you transfer everything! Molloy is NOT honoring Dowling Scholarships. molloy.edu/dowling

St. Joseph's College: Patchogue, they are NOT holding strong to their 90 transfer credit maximum and they will be allowing more than 90 credits to transfer depending on particular courses you have left to complete. They are having a transfer event on Monday between 10 and 4 where they are inviting students to come and discuss further your option to transfer to St. Josephs. You need to RSVP to the event.
"I just left my appointment with St. Joseph's. I only had one class left at Dowling and they seem to be pretty serious about transferring more than 90 credits.I sat with an advisor, who I ended up just leaving my transcripts with because of the amount of time she would need to go through them. She told me if I need 12 credits or less to from St. Joseph's my diploma will be from NYS but if I have over 12 credits to complete at St. Joseph's my diploma will be from St. Joseph's.Dowling also has very different majors and requirements for majors which is odd, but she said they are working with students to accommodate what they can and make your Dowling courses equivalent to St. Joseph’s courses. Also, higher level major courses that have been completed need Department Chair approval to be transferred in instead of taken at St. Joseph’s.I have a follow up appointment on Wednesday where she will tell me where I stand at St. Joseph's and how many credits I have left. Everything there still seems up in the air but I am hoping they pull through for me. I will let you guys know the outcome if they are truly being helpful with transferring more than 90 credits." -Joan Kraft
Stony Brook: for those looking for cheaper options, they are taking a maximum of 84 credits and are not willing to budge on that.

Suffolk County Community College: has opened a dedicated hotline at 631-451-4111 for Dowling students looking to access information regarding financial aid, academic counseling and admissions counseling.
SCCC has also waived its application fee of $40 and will defer transcript and immunization requirements for Dowling students looking to transfer. The college is looking to offer evening hours on its campuses as well. Visit www.SUNYSuffolk.edu for updates.
Vaughn College: In light of the closure of Dowling College announced earlier this week, VaughnCollege will provide assistance to students to support them in the completion of their degree. For those who would like to transfer the following assistance is available:
•Waiving the residency requirements for those students with fewer than 30 remaining credits left to graduate •Waiving the application fee •Providing individual academic and financial evaluations •Hosting informational transfer sessions online and in-person. “We will make every effort to provide a transfer process to Vaughn that is simple, as well as attempt to provide a package that is as close as possible to each student’s current cost of attendance,” said Vice President of Enrollment Services Ernie Shepelsky. “Individual needs will be considered as we assist students with completing their degrees.” Dowling College and Vaughn College are the only institutions in the New York region that are part of the Federal Aviation Administration’s (FAA) Collegiate Training Initiative (CTI), which prepares students to pursue an air traffic control position with the FAA. This designation could allow students to make a seamless transfer from one CTI program to another. Vaughn is also exploring flight training options for Dowling transfers that may allow them to retain all of their current training hours.
